Town Hosting Forum On Keeping LI Sound Clean
The public forum will discuss keeping plastic bags out of the Long Island Sound.

Huntington town officials are hosting a forum to discuss keeping plastic bags out of the Long Island Sound on Thursday at town hall.
The forum will be run by Adrienne Esposito of Citizens Campaign for the Environment, Rob DiGiovanni of Atlantic Marine Conservation Society and Christina Manto of Wildlife Conservation Society, and will begin at 7 p.m.
"Plastic pollution is a growing threat to our waterways globally and to our marine life locally," according to the town. "An estimated 267 species of marine and avian life are impacted by our addiction to throw-away plastics, including whales, turtles, seals, and dolphins that populate the Long Island Sound and surrounding NY waters."
